Smith Mountain Lake State Park in Huddleston,VA is a must-visit for nature lovers. Visitors rave about the parks beautiful scenery and abundant hiking trails that run along the lake. The campground is well-maintained and has clean restrooms, which visitors appreciate. The campsites are spacious and offer enough privacy with trees between them. Some sites are not level and require some adjustments. The park is great for tent and RV campers with water and electric available at the sites. A dump station is conveniently located at the exit. Visitors can enjoy swimming and relaxing at the beach, which is only a short drive away from the campground. The park is not suitable for cyclists, but its well-maintained gravel roads are great for hiking. Visitors with boats might find the lack of kayak boat launch or site for car-top loaded boats inconvenient. Overall, despite some minor shortcomings, Smith Mountain Lake State Park is a great destination for family camping, hiking, and exploring the lake.
From The Campground
Smith Mountain Lake State Park offers a variety of camping options including cabins, tent sites, and RV sites. The park also features a camping lodge (bunkhouse) for rent. The park has 13 hiking trails, a 500-foot beach, and ample opportunities for fishing and boating. The park has a small meeting space, a visitor center with a gift shop, and a snack bar by the beach. The park is open from the first Friday in March through the first Monday in December.
